Poonam Kasturi calls herself Compost Wali. On a unique mission, she wants ordinary Indians to feel empowered, make a ‘clean’ difference to the society, by converting waste into useful compost in a simple and cost effective manner. “Recycling green waste as compost could match the environmental benefits of converting it into renewable energy, in terms of CO2 savings, according to new German research. It suggests that the two forms of waste management should be seen as complementary and both should receive subsidies. Green waste is biodegradable waste, usually from gardens and parks, [...]

In urban slum areas without proper waste disposal and rubbish collection systems the build up of household waste is a huge problem. One of WaterAid’s projects in India has found a novel approach to tackle this dilemma and generate income. Their solution lies with worms. Reuse and recycling of wastes has great economical promise. Industrial woody waste, agricultural wastes, pruned branches, bagasse and chaff can be gainfully recycled to produce Ethanol. The Technology centers round recycling, material recovery and fuel recovery. The acid hydrolysis process is used to decompose hemi cellulose to pentose with a main ingredient of Xylose. The [...]
